PSG star Neymar labelled as ‘biggest flop in football history’

Brazil superstar Neymar has been labelled as the biggest flop in football history following his recent poor performances with PSG in French Ligue 1.

The 30-year old had a good start to the season before joining Seleçao for the World Cup in Qatar, scoring 15 goals and providing 12 assists.

However, he is having a difficult comeback since the World Cup ended with the former Barcelona star being sent off for his first match with PSG after the competition in Qatar.

His attitude and performance in the last PSG league loss against Rennes (0-1) during the week-end got many frustrated.

Among them, RMC Sport pundit Daniel Riolo who heavily criticized Neymar who he labelled as a flop.

“Do we realize that Neymar, in terms of transfer and salary, is the biggest flop in the history of football?” he wondered.

“I can’t think of a bigger flop for what he cost, it’s horrible.

“Just because he was good in two round of 16 games in 2020 doesn’t mean he’s going to save your life.”
